How they compare
Côte d'Ivoire currently reports 165.31 % against 76.59 % in Net Food Importing Developing Countries (NFIDCs), a difference of 88.72 %.
That makes Côte d'Ivoire's figure about 2.2 times Net Food Importing Developing Countries (NFIDCs)'s.
Across all 63 years both countries report, Côte d'Ivoire has been ahead every year.
Côte d'Ivoire ranks 6th and Net Food Importing Developing Countries (NFIDCs) ranks 9th of 38 regions.
Côte d'Ivoire has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Côte d'Ivoire | Net Food Importing Developing Countries (NFIDCs) |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 317.14 % | 124.52 % | 192.63 % | Côte d'Ivoire |
| 1970s | 233.28 % | 104.13 % | 129.15 % | Côte d'Ivoire |
| 1980s | 257.38 % | 79.99 % | 177.39 % | Côte d'Ivoire |
| 1990s | 232.18 % | 85.64 % | 146.53 % | Côte d'Ivoire |
| 2000s | 281.7 % | 90.77 % | 190.93 % | Côte d'Ivoire |
| 2010s | 221.71 % | 81.97 % | 139.74 % | Côte d'Ivoire |
| 2020s | 218.89 % | 76.33 % | 142.56 % | Côte d'Ivoire |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The Cropland Nutrient balance domain contains information on the flows of n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ium from mineral fertilizer, manure applied, atmospheric deposition, crop removal, and biological fixation over cropland and per unit area of cropland. The flows are aggregated to total inputs and total outputs, from which the overall nutrient balance and nutrient use efficiency on cropland are calculated. Statistics are disseminated in units of tonnes and in kg/ha, as appropriate. Nutrient use efficiency is expressed as a fraction (%).
